PostgreSQL is a solution for developers and organizations seeking a long-term, secure, and technically advanced platform. Thanks to its robust architecture, active community, and continuous development, PostgreSQL remains one of the most reliable database platforms today—ideal for data-heavy web applications, internal systems, and software tailored to specific business needs.
PostgreSQL: Advanced Open-Source Database System for Demanding Applications
PostgreSQL is a powerful and highly reliable open-source relational database system that has earned a strong reputation among professional developers and organizations focused on stable, scalable, and data-intensive applications. Actively developed since 1986, its commitment to standards, data consistency, and open architecture has made it one of the most advanced database tools on the market.
Key Features of PostgreSQL
PostgreSQL fully supports SQL standards while offering features that go far beyond typical relational databases. These include transactions with MVCC (Multiversion Concurrency Control), full-text search, materialized views, advanced index types (GIN, GiST, BRIN), partial and functional indexes, as well as nested queries and window functions. Developers also benefit from native support for JSON, XML, and binary data; the ability to define custom types, operators, and aggregates; and support for multiple programming languages for procedural logic—including PL/pgSQL, Python, and JavaScript.
Practical Benefits of PostgreSQL
PostgreSQL is designed for systems where data integrity, transactional safety, and flexible data modeling are essential. For developers, it provides advanced features without the need for commercial add-ons, extensive extensibility, and powerful tools for monitoring, debugging, and performance management. Tools like psql, pgAdmin, EXPLAIN, auto_explain, pg_stat_statements, and pgBackRest simplify administration and optimization. For businesses, PostgreSQL offers high scalability, zero licensing costs, and smooth deployment across on-premise, hybrid, and cloud environments (including AWS, GCP, and Azure).
Use Cases of PostgreSQL
PostgreSQL is widely used in e-commerce, fintech, telecommunications, geoinformation systems (e.g., with the PostGIS extension), BI tools, data warehouses, and the public sector. It is an excellent choice for modern web backends, microservices, GraphQL servers, and analytical platforms dealing with large data volumes. With built-in support for replication, partitioning, and logical streaming, PostgreSQL is suitable even in environments with high availability and scalability requirements.